Based on Alessandro Mendini's 'Poltrona di Proust' chair, designed in 1978, Magis' 2011 'Proust' chair is the same designer's contemporary update on the original. The first incarnation of the seat, which is characterised by continuous hand painted multi-coloured dots applied using the pointillism technique, is relived in this industrial rotational-moulded piece, where weatherproof polyethylene is shaped into a romantic, baroque chair that is suited to both indoor and outdoor use.
